James Cobb pled guilty today in an Elmore County courtroom on two counts of sexual misconduct involving children under the age of 12.
The plea and sentence is in reference to Cobb’s original arrest in September of 2020.
As part of the plea agreement, Cobb admitted his guilt before Circuit Court Judge Sibley Reynolds. He was sentenced to two years of probation and must attend court ordered, mandatory counseling. Cobb will be a registered sex offender in the state of Alabama.
Assistant District Attorney Amanda Johnson told the EAN the plea agreement was made with the approval of the victims’ family members. “After extensive meetings with the victims and their parents, the parents made the decision that they did not want their children to have to testify in court, and agreed to the plea agreement.”
